Title: Shingo Sasaki: Innovator in Amorphous Carbon and Powder Coatings
Introduction
Shingo Sasaki is a notable inventor based in Aichi, Japan. He has made significant contributions to the fields of materials science and engineering, particularly in the development of amorphous carbon molded articles and advanced resin compositions for powder coatings. With a total of 2 patents, his work has implications across various industries.
Latest Patents
Sasaki's latest patents include a precursor of amorphous carbon molded article and a resin composition for powder coatings. The precursor patent describes a phenolic resin molding material that is coated with a low-surface tension substance, which is free from metallic components. This innovation allows for the production of a transparent precursor that is homogenized and has minimal voids and low metal content. The process for molding this precursor involves controlling the water content during shaping, utilizing methods such as transfer molding, extrusion, and injection molding. The resulting amorphous carbon molded article is particularly useful in metallurgical and chemical industries, as well as in the electronic industry for applications like plasma etchers and substrates.
The resin composition for powder coatings patent outlines a formulation that combines a carboxyl group containing polyester resin and a glycidyl group containing acrylic resin. This composition is designed to create a paint film that exhibits the desirable characteristics of both polyester and acrylic resins, including high smoothness, gloss, strength, hardness, stain resistance, and weatherability.
Career Highlights
Throughout his career, Shingo Sasaki has worked with prominent companies such as Unitika Ltd. and Mitsui Toatsu Chemicals, Incorporated. His experience in these organizations has contributed to his expertise in materials development and innovation.
Collaborations
Sasaki has collaborated with notable coworkers, including Kazuyuki Wakamura and Taisaku Kano. These partnerships have likely enhanced his research and development efforts, leading to successful innovations.
